Patrick Coulombe wrote: > > hi, > if I do a query like this one : > > SELECT name from medias ORDER BY name > > name > ---- > AAAA > CCCC > EEEE > VVVV > ZZZZ > ÉCCC > ---- > 6 rows > > Why the record : ÉCCC is at the end? > HOW can I fix this? > > Thank you > Patrick Hello, I have the same problem (the character is not recognized - we also use french) and it seems that the only way around this "bug" is to install Postgres with a local package... but many told me that is was slower and not very useful... I did not try it. Instead, we plan to create a second column with same french data but without accents... The query will be based on that field for the order by needs... not great, but I will do exactly what we expect and no add-ons. Hope this helps!
